"12 WOD's of Christmas"

For Time:

1 Sumo Deadlift High Pull (75#/55#)
2 Thrusters (75#/55#)
3 Push Press (75#/55#)
4 Power Cleans (75#/55#)
5 Deadlifts (75#/55#)
6 Kettlebell Swings (53#/35#)
7 Pull-ups
8 Knees-to-Elbows
9 Box Jumps (24″/20″)
10 Double Unders
11 Overhead Walking Lunge Steps (45#/25# Plate)
12 Burpees

* Like the song the “12 Days of Christmas”, complete each exercise in ascending order then work back down, adding one exercise per round. 

Ex. On the 1st day of Christmas, my coaches gave to me, one Sumo Deadlift High Pull; on the 2nd day of Christmas my coaches gave to me, 2 Thrusters and 1 SDHP; on the 3rd day of Christmas, my coaches gave to me, 3 Push Press, 2 Thrusters, and 1 SDHP; etc. up to 12.

Most of you managed to fall into the rhythm of our traditional annual “12 WOD’s of Christmas” workout (there’s always a couple who go backwards or do extra reps for awhile). The first five exercises are meant to be a “barbell complex” where the sequence of movements progress together. It forces you to be more efficient and “link” them so that after you complete the Deadlifts you transition to the Power Cleans then the Push Presses, Thrusters, and Sumo Deadlift High-Pull without putting the barbell down. There are endless combinations to this type of 12 Days WOD in CrossFit but this one keeps both the reps of each movement and load low, and the workout generally fast and reasonable. What is the Advanced RX Challenge? It’s a test that is required for participation in our Advanced RX Class on Saturdays at 10:45. You must pass to attend the class, coaches included.   

If you are considering taking the test then you must be motivated to attend the class regularly as well as considering competing in the Open or other local CrossFit competitions. The purpose of this class is to offer programming and class environment geared towards more advanced movements and higher intensity. It is not a test that is open to just “take to see where you are” and “see if you can do it”.  It takes a lot of time, logistics and at least one coach to properly judge and execute. You must approach us about the test and ask to take it. We will then work out a schedule and give you honest feedback of what you should be doing to be ready. Not passing is still a great thing as it will highlight the advanced skills, lifts, and loads you have to work on; but you should already have a very good idea of what you can and cannot pass and be working on those skills. 

It is made up of several basic, intermediate and advanced movements and skills. They were intended to test the skill movements and loads that are fairly common in the majority of CrossFit programming. The exercises picked represent Olympic Lifting, Power Lifting, body-weight skills, movements that demand core strength and coordination, and the generation of power through explosive hip drive. We have modified this test over the past several years; modifying some exercises, loads, and standards for which reps would count. Could they have been heavier or harder? Sure. However these are the common movements and loads that when combined with various cardiorespiratory endurance exercises form the workout of the day that is as RX’d (Prescribed).

Movember. One of my favorite times in the gym. Right after all the Halloween costumes of the Frankenchipper begins the time for growing a mustache worthy of Tom Selleck, Ron Burgundy, or Hulk Hogan (at least in my mind). We had over 10 guys grow their Mo this year with everything ranging from the “walrus”, trucker”,”Magnum P.I.”, to the “after Eight”. Next year I hope we get either a “Viking” or a “Captain Hook”. This art of of manliness is also for worthy causes; the fight against prostate and testicular cancer. This year we raised more than a couple hundred bucks as Team SnoRidge MoBros. This was our 3rd annual SRCF Movember with our 3rd exclusive t-shirt and the final day of the month ending with the MoBros WOD.
